Francois Flocard has over 15 years of applied experience in consulting engineering projects, focusing on coastal engineering and the marine renewable energy sector. He has managed projects involving coastal hazards, structures, climate change adaptation, and physical and numerical modeling, as well as coastal monitoring. With expertise in marine renewables, he has overseen the installation of a 250 kW pilot device in Victoria and led large studies related to wave dynamics and energy conversion. His work includes modeling 30 coastal and offshore structure projects in the last decade, leading to numerous publications in physical modeling methods, case studies, and assessments of rock and concrete armored structures. He is recognized as one of Australia’s foremost experts in using physical models to analyze coastal and marine structures and regularly conducts numerical modeling investigations for coastal processes and hazards. His projects span from Tasmania to Darwin and within the Australasia region. Additionally, he is an active member of the marine renewable energy and coastal engineering communities, participating in committees such as the PIANC and the Australian Standard committee for marine energy converters.
